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
· Utilize a variety of assessment tools which may include the Verbal Behavior Milestones Assessment and Placement Program and Adaptive Behavior Assessment System, to write operationally defined goals and objectives.
· Treat problem behavior with a function-based approach, utilizing teaching procedures based in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A).
· Consistently and frequently analyze data on treatment goals and adjust teaching procedures and intervention strategies according to data, collecting functional assessment data when appropriate.
· Involve the family in treatment by meeting with parents/guardians consistently providing consultations and/or providing training sessions as needed and ensuring treatment plans include parent goals.
· Train staff and other professionals to implement ABA treatment plans.
· Assess the patient’s treatment needs and write detailed goals and objectives for each patient’s treatment plan so that progress may be tracked and measured.
· Work closely with the interdisciplinary team to facilitate the optimum behavior plan.
· Oversee implementation of programming, data collection, and procedural fidelity of Registered Behavior Technicians and Behavior Technicians.
· Maintain and complete reports and session/supervision notes.
· Conduct appropriate assessments which may include ADOS and other specific assessments in a timely manner.
· Create programming procedures and materials and complete all necessary documentation requirements timely.
· Demonstrate a positive, empathetic and professional attitude towards customers always. When patient needs are not met, acknowledge and work to resolved complaints. Recognize that patient safety is a top priority.

EDUCATION/EXPERIENCE/SKILL REQUIREMENTS:
· Certification by the Behavior Analyst certification Board required.
· Master’s degree in special education, psychology, or related field, with specialized knowledge of behavioral health and treatment philosophies and professional practices.
· Three years’ experience working with individuals who have autism spectrum disorders preferred.
· Prior experience with ABA programming required.
LICENSES/DESIGNATIONS/CERTIFICATIONS:
· Certification/Licensure as required by state.
· CPR and de-escalation/restraint certification required (training available upon hire and offered by facility).
· First aid may be required based on state or facility.
